Group Efficiency
Refers to the effectiveness with which a group is able to achieve its objectives, often measured by the outputs or outcomes produced by the collective efforts of its members.
Rationalization
The application of economic logic to human activity; the use of formal rules and regulations in order to maximize efficiency without consideration of subjective or individual concerns.
Social Identity Theory
A theory of group formation and maintenance that stresses the need of individual members to feel a sense of belonging.
Teamwork
The collaborative effort of a group aimed at achieving a common goal or completing a task in the most effective and efficient way.
